59 Impala Posted September 15, 2017 Posted September 15, 2017 I'm rebuilding this glue bomb and I sprayed Boyd's True Blue Pearl over Black for the main body. The interior, top and coves were sprayed with Boyd's Pacific Blue. The top also has a coat of dull cote to tone it down. Here are some pics of it as of today. I had to repair the front end so that I could pose the wheels. You can't turn them very much because of the headers though. I will use BMF probably tomorrow night and our Nerd Night at the hobby shop. Thanks fer lookin. Dan

59 Impala Posted September 18, 2017 Author Posted September 18, 2017 She's a gittin thar fur sure. I used BMF and chrome pen for the trim. I removed the headers and trimmed a tad bit off of the ends and shorten them up a bit. I have re-installed them and will take pics soon. I also had to trim off the pins for the interior so that the interior would let the body go forward a tad. There was about a 1/16th gap between the body and flip front, so, somethin had to be done to close the gap. It still not perfect but it will do. I also moved the engine back a tad to help in this problem and now I have to trim the drive shaft to fit. Thanks fer lookin. Dan
